Ep 839: Young Stock Podcast - Episode 54 - Farm partnership with your grandparents
24/07/2023 Duración: 19minOn this weeks Young Stock Podcast Sarah McIntosh talks to dairy farmer and NDC farm ambassador Nicole Keohane. Nicole Keohane outlines her time studying agriculture in South East Technological University [formally WIT] and where her intrest in agriculture came from. She is currently an ambassador for the National Dairy Council (NDC) where she strives to promote the positives of the dairy industry and showcase the work being done by farmers across Ireland to improve sustainability and farming practices. Being a keen Macra member, Nicole emphasises there is a club for everyone (even if your living in Dublin like me). She also sold me on the idea of attending this years Queen of the Land festival that is on in November. Having spent the last two years working on a PhD in 'A non-antibiotic approach to improving udder health in Irish dairy cows' it has now turned into a Master's. This has given Nicole the opportunity to go into partnership with her grandparents on their family fairy farm over the next few months.

Ep 837: Farming News - tax changes mooted and suckler farmer unease
20/07/2023 Duración: 32minOur news team discusses how some of Ireland’s farm and land tax changes are under review, farmer anger over a mooted suckler herd decline, continued fallout from the RTÉ Investigates calf welfare report, the impact of derogation changes, nature restoration and the wet weather. Ep 829: Farming News - nitrates changes and farmer views from Moorepark
06/07/2023 Duración: 41minOur news team discusses the latest on the changes to Ireland’s nitrates derogation, dairy cow cull scheme proposals, beef prices, gene edited crops, an organic dairy farm and mink attacks on poultry.
